"korner" meaning in Tagalog

See korner in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: /ˈkoɾneɾ/ [Standard-Tagalog], [ˈkoɾ.n̪ɛɾ] [Standard-Tagalog] Forms: ᜃᜓᜇ᜔ᜈᜒᜇ᜔ [Baybayin]
Rhymes: -oɾneɾ Etymology: Borrowed from English corner, from Middle English corner, from Anglo-Norman cornere, from Old French corne (“corner, angle”, literally “a horn, projecting point”), from Vulgar Latin *corna (“horn”), from Latin cornua, plural of cornū (“projecting point, end, horn”).   1. corner (point where two converging lines meet) Synonyms: sulok, kanto, eskina

  2. act of cornering (driving into a corner) Synonyms: sukol, pikot
